Tottenham Hotspur Foundation coach Sabrina Dias happy with RFYC infrastructure

Dias said that the Reliance Foundation and their initiatives should be a benchmark for football development in India

Tottenham Hotspur Foundation football coach Sabrina Dias expressed satisfaction after visiting the Reliance Foundation Young Champs (RFYC) in Navi Mumbai last week. Her purpose of visiting the RFYC infrastructure was to make an assessment, engaging with fans and promote the development of football at grassroots level. 

In addition to engaging with coaches and young enthusiasts of the sport, Dias also engaged in an insightful session with the RFYC players from different age categories.

Dias said that the Reliance Foundation and their initiatives should be a benchmark for football development in India and celebrated the RFYC facility to be on par with global standards. She explained that the entire program, which propelled 12 graduates from the 2023 batch to sign professional contracts with Indian clubs, is designed in a way that takes care of an all-round, holistic development of a youngster. 

 

 

“What I saw at the Reliance Foundation Young Champs academy is excellent. I have coached for five years now. I have been to Switzerland, countries like South Korea, but I have never seen something like that. What I saw was totally excellent, and it is really good for the boys,” Dias said in an interaction.
